Output 65d7781965ca6c41ef1574f9a5c6f28e25ba272bace354dc13c80df24a1816e0:0

value
377892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b150ad2efebbe75d74a5e3ce4f9d11af667cd331 OP_EQUALVERIFY OP_CHECKSIG
address
1HAZFTQqAWuDtAJxa8uWi15mazQisuEV56
transaction
65d7781965ca6c41ef1574f9a5c6f28e25ba272bace354dc13c80df24a1816e0
spent
true